Does Amazon Refund Less Than What You Paid?

Amazon generally refunds the full amount you paid, including taxes and shipping fees. However, if you used a promotion or coupon, they might refund only what you actually paid out-of-pocket. It’s best to check Amazon’s refund policy or contact their customer service for specifics related to your order.

- What should I do if I believe my Amazon refund is incorrect? Contact Amazon customer service directly to clarify the refund amount and resolve any discrepancies.
- Can I return an item I bought with a coupon? Yes, but the refund will be based on the amount you actually paid after applying the coupon.
- How long does it take to get a refund from Amazon? Refunds are generally processed within 3-5 business days after the return is received.
- Are shipping fees refundable on Amazon orders? Shipping fees can be refunded if the return is due to a mistake from Amazon's side.
